Transaction 89283245149e291361ae19d8692638a29bd34741188d16567ced679cc83c4708
1 Input
1 Output
-
89283245149e291361ae19d8692638a29bd34741188d16567ced679cc83c4708:0
- value
- 256636
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 feece58edd664ad1ea41959dd421902feec489e2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QEvRbdFDjkJ4RPGYbYmtESLicExvbcwXd